public class NativeLibraryLoader
extends java.lang.Object
| Constructor and Description |
|---|
NativeLibraryLoader(java.lang.String libraryName,
java.util.function.Predicate<SystemType> systemFilter,
NativeLibraryProperties properties,
NativeLibraryBinaryProvider binaryProvider) |
| Modifier and Type | Method and Description |
|---|---|
static NativeLibraryLoader |
create(java.lang.Class<?> classLoaderSample,
java.lang.String libraryName) |
static NativeLibraryLoader |
createFiltered(java.lang.Class<?> classLoaderSample,
java.lang.String libraryName,
java.util.function.Predicate<SystemType> systemFilter) |
void |
load() |
public NativeLibraryLoader(java.lang.String libraryName,
java.util.function.Predicate<SystemType> systemFilter,
NativeLibraryProperties properties,
NativeLibraryBinaryProvider binaryProvider)
public static NativeLibraryLoader create(java.lang.Class<?> classLoaderSample, java.lang.String libraryName)
public static NativeLibraryLoader createFiltered(java.lang.Class<?> classLoaderSample, java.lang.String libraryName, java.util.function.Predicate<SystemType> systemFilter)
public void load()